    We are looking for a Governance Officer to join our Legal and Governance team.

    Title: Governance Officer

    Salary: £30,862 per annum (£38,577 full-time equivalent)

    Contract: Fixed term (12 months)

    Hours: 28 per week (4 days)

    Location: Hybrid*, withhead office in Hampstead, London

    The Governance Officer is a vital role and effective governance reporting and oversight is essential to the charity's function. The current Governance Officer has been seconded to Head of Commercial Operations and as such, this role will be covering her position whilst she is on secondment for 12 months. You will help manage Anthony Nolan and Anthony Nolan Trading Limited's strategic engagement with the Board of Trustees, supporting the Director of Legal and Governance, with oversight from the Head of Operations, in all governance matters and working with the Board, the Strategic Leadership Team, the CEO's team and other key stakeholders to ensure the effective governance of the charity.

    To be successful you will have an eye for detail and a strong interest in corporate governance underlined by improving organisational process, transparency and accountability throughout Anthony Nolan. Strong interpersonal skills and resilience are also important as is the ability to deal with confidential information with the utmost discretion.
